SiWave by Keysight is a powerful simulation tool designed for the analysis of high-frequency signal integrity and power integrity in printed circuit boards (PCBs) and packaging designs. It provides electromagnetic (EM) simulation capabilities that help engineers optimize their designs for high-speed digital and RF applications, ensuring minimal signal loss, crosstalk, and electromagnetic interference.
Key Features
- Integrated 3D EM simulation environment
- Supports both differential and single-ended signal analysis
- Ability to simulate complex PCB geometries and packages
- Advanced solvers for accurate frequency domain and time domain analysis
- Visualization tools for S-parameters, impedance, and near/far field patterns
- Seamless integration with Keysight's design environment and other EDA tools
- Automated model creation from CAD layouts
Pros
- Highly accurate electromagnetic simulations suitable for complex designs
- User-friendly interface with automation features to streamline workflows
- Robust support for various modeling types including multilayer PCBs
- Effective visualization tools aid in diagnosing issues
- Integration with broader Keysight ecosystem enhances usability
Cons
- Relatively high cost which may be prohibitive for small teams or hobbyists
- Steep learning curve for new users unfamiliar with EM simulation concepts
- Long simulation run times for very complex models without adequate computational resources
